DoorDash Order Ledger

Every dd-cli command the agent runs is recorded by the doordash-audit-log hook in ~/.claude/dd-guard/audit.jsonl — one versioned JSON line per event. This skill teaches you to answer questions from that log instead of guessing.

Install the bundle: hook doordash/doordash-audit-log (the recorder), command /doordash-report (reconciled summaries), this skill (querying). Composes with doordash-spend-guard (shares the ~/.claude/dd-guard/ state directory) but runs standalone.

Line schema (v1)

json
{
  "v": 1,
  "ts": "2026-07-19T13:02:11",
  "session_id": "abc123",
  "cwd": "/Users/x/project",
  "command": "dd-cli search --query \"ramen near me\"",
  "event_type": "search | cart_mutation | checkout_url | history | login | other",
  "cart_uuid": "…or null",
  "order_uuid": "…or null",
  "exit_ok": true
}

Commands are secret-stripped before persisting and truncated to 500 chars. The v field guards future schema changes — check it before assuming fields.

Query recipes (jq)

Answer from data, not memory:

bash
# What did the agent do today?
jq -r 'select(.ts >= "2026-07-19") | "\(.ts) \(.event_type) \(.command)"' ~/.claude/dd-guard/audit.jsonl

# Checkout URLs issued this week (intents, not confirmed orders)
jq -r 'select(.event_type == "checkout_url" and .ts >= "2026-07-13")' ~/.claude/dd-guard/audit.jsonl

# Activity by type
jq -s 'group_by(.event_type) | map({type: .[0].event_type, n: length})' ~/.claude/dd-guard/audit.jsonl

# Which sessions touched carts?
jq -r 'select(.event_type == "cart_mutation") | .session_id' ~/.claude/dd-guard/audit.jsonl | sort | uniq -c

# Failed dd-cli calls (agent flailing?)
jq -r 'select(.exit_ok == false) | "\(.ts) \(.command)"' ~/.claude/dd-guard/audit.jsonl

When the user asks a money question ("how much this week?"), prefer /doordash-report — it reconciles against real dd-cli order history and labels intent-only numbers honestly. Raw checkout_url counts are intents: the human may have abandoned the payment page.

Honest semantics

  • checkout_url ≠ purchase. It records that a link was issued. Only reconciliation against order history confirms money moved.
  • Subtotals (when present via doordash-spend-guard's ledger) are pre-fee.
  • The log records what went through Claude Code's Bash tool — orders placed by the human directly in a terminal or app are invisible to it.

Maintenance

  • Rotation: when audit.jsonl exceeds ~5 MB, rotate: mv audit.jsonl audit-$(date +%Y%m).jsonl && gzip audit-*.jsonl (keep the gzips; they are the history).
  • Never edit lines — append-only is the audit property. Corrections go in reports, not in the log.
  • Privacy: this is a plaintext record of eating habits and schedules. Keep ~/.claude/dd-guard/ out of repos and backups you share. Mention this to the user the first time you query the log in a session.
